服务器写日志什么权限?
服务器写日志通常需要管理员权限或特定的日志写入权限,这是因为日志文件通常位于系统或应用程序的关键目录中,并且记录着重要的操作和事件信息,为了保障系统的安全性和稳定性,只有具备相应权限的用户才能对日志进行写入操作,这样可以确保日志的完整性和准确性,并防止未经授权的修改或删除,在进行服务器日志写入时,需要确保用户具备合适的权限,以确保日志的正常记录和系统的安全运行。
服务器日志权限详解
随着信息技术的飞速发展,服务器广泛应用于各行各业,为了确保服务器的正常运行及安全性,写日志成为了服务器管理的重要环节,本文将详细阐述在服务器写日志的过程中,需要具备的权限以及相应的权限管理策略。
服务器日志概述
服务器日志是记录服务器运行过程中的各种事件、操作及系统状态的文件,通过对日志的分析,管理员可以了解服务器的运行状态,识别潜在的安全风险,并优化服务器性能,常见的服务器日志包括系统日志、应用日志、安全日志等。
写日志权限分析
在服务器写日志的过程中,涉及到的主要权限包括操作系统权限、应用权限及安全权限。
操作系统权限
在Linux系统中,写日志通常需要具备相应的文件系统权限,日志文件一般存放在特定目录下,如/var/log/目录,为了确保日志的正常写入,服务器上的日志记录进程需要有对应目录的写权限,为了确保日志的完整性和安全性,还需要对日志文件进行轮替和备份,这通常需要管理员权限(如root权限)。
应用权限
在服务器上运行的应用程序也会产生日志,这些日志的写入权限通常由应用程序自身管理,不同的应用程序可能有不同的日志写入机制和安全要求,为了确保应用日志的正常写入,需要为应用程序提供相应的日志写权限。
安全权限
为了确保服务器日志的安全性,还需要对日志的访问进行权限控制,防止敏感信息泄露,还需要对日志的篡改进行监控和防范,以确保日志的真实性和完整性,为了实现这些功能,通常需要设置相应的安全权限,如ACL(访问控制列表)或SELinux(安全增强Linux)。
权限管理策略
为了确保服务器写日志的权限得到合理管理,需要制定以下策略:
- 最小权限原则:为日志写入进程和应用程序提供最小必要的权限,避免过度授权导致的安全风险。
- 权限分离原则:将日志写入、备份、访问等职责分配给不同的用户或用户组,以实现职责分离,降低内部风险。
- 审计和监控:对日志的访问和操作进行审计和监控,确保日志的安全性。
- 定期审查:定期对权限设置进行审查,确保权限的合理性,还需要加强对日志管理的培训和意识提升,确保所有相关人员都了解并遵循相关的权限和策略规定。
建议
- 定期对服务器日志进行审查和分析,以便及时发现潜在的安全风险。
- 根据实际需求,为日志写入进程和应用程序提供合适的权限。
- 加强权限管理,遵循最小权限原则和权限分离原则。
- 加强对日志访问和操作的安全监控和审计,确保日志的安全性,为了提高日志管理的效率,建议使用专业的日志管理工具或软件,以便更好地收集、存储、分析和归档日志数据。
服务器写日志是确保服务器正常运行和安全性的重要环节,在写日志的过程中,需要具备操作系统权限、应用权限和安全权限,为了确保权限的合理管理,需要制定相应的权限管理策略,通过合理的权限管理和策略制定,可以确保服务器日志的完整性和安全性,为服务器的运行和管理提供有力支持。
